WebJun 21, 2024 · You might think the roar of airplane engines would be enough to drive birds away. But plane engines have a lower pitch than birdsong, so birds can still "talk" over them. The sounds of the "sonic net" are more similar to those of a bird's voice. WebAirport trash and food waste, when not carefully managed, can attract birds such as gulls, rock pigeons (Columba livia), starlings, and other species closely associated with humans. Seeds and fruits produced by airport landscaping plants and naturally-occurring trees and shrubs can attract many types of birds. In some places, airports are experimenting with planting grasses that geese do not like to eat. Other examples include removing ponds and fruit-bearing trees. Salt Lake City has replaced grass with gravel between runways. grass withers verseWebJan 1, 2008 · The most effective are methods reducing the carrying capacity of the environment at the airport.
